How Does Durability Affect the Lifespan of Luggage?

Durability directly affects the lifespan of luggage. Durable luggage can withstand rough handling during travel. Strong materials, such as high-denier nylon or polycarbonate, resist wear and tear. Luggage with reinforced stitching and high-quality zippers reduces the risk of damage. When luggage endures harsh conditions, it lasts longer. Frequent travel increases stress on luggage, so durability is essential. Durable luggage requires fewer repairs or replacements, saving money over time. Travelers can rely on durable luggage for multiple trips, enhancing its value. In summary, durability supports the longevity and reliability of luggage during its use.

In What Ways Do Features Enhance Luggage Usability?

Features enhance luggage usability in various ways. They improve functionality, convenience, and security. For example, wheels provide easy mobility. A lightweight design reduces strain during travel. Ergonomic handles allow for comfortable gripping. Compartments and pockets help organize belongings efficiently.

Water-resistant materials protect contents from moisture. Locking mechanisms offer enhanced security against theft. Expandable zippers increase packing capacity when needed. GPS trackers assist in locating lost luggage. Durability ensures that luggage withstands wear and tear.

Design elements, like bright colors or unique patterns, make luggage easily identifiable. Built-in chargers for devices provide added convenience for travelers. Overall, these features work together to make traveling smoother and more enjoyable.

  5. Travelpro:
    Travelpro is a brand that originated from the needs of airline pilots and crew. Known for its practicality, Travelpro luggage is designed to withstand rough handling. The brand incorporates features like zippered expansion and sturdy handles. A 2023 Consumer Reviews study indicated that Travelpro consistently performed well in stress tests for durability. The Platinum Elite series, for instance, has been praised for its balanced combination of comfort and functionality suitable for frequent business travel.

What Common Testing Procedures Are Used to Evaluate Luggage Quality?

Common testing procedures used to evaluate luggage quality include durability tests, weight tests, and functionality assessments.

  1. Durability Tests
  2. Weight Tests
  3. Functionality Assessments
  4. Water Resistance Tests
  5. Zipper Performance Tests
  6. Wheel Mobility Tests
  7. Safety Features Evaluation
  8. Size and Capacity Measurements
  9. Material Quality Analysis

Durability Tests: Durability tests evaluate how well luggage can withstand wear and tear over time. These tests simulate real-life scenarios, such as being dropped or tossed. A common method involves subjecting luggage to various impacts and abrasions to assess its resistance. The American Society for Testing and Materials (ASTM) provides standards for such tests. For example, luggage tested with a drop test may reveal how well it maintains its shape and functionality after repeated impacts.

Weight Tests: Weight tests determine the weight of luggage and its ability to carry loads without damage. This includes testing how much weight the luggage can hold before its structure fails. According to a study by the International Air Transport Association (IATA), excessive weight can lead to luggage damage. Brands often specify limits for added safety. Testing includes placing weights inside luggage and monitoring for deformation or failure.

Functionality Assessments: Functionality assessments test how well luggage meets user needs. This includes examining the ease of accessing compartments, the effectiveness of security features, and user-friendliness. A case study by Consumer Reports found that luggage should have easily usable handles and locks to enhance user experience. User feedback often plays a key role in this evaluation.

Water Resistance Tests: Water resistance tests check how well luggage can protect contents from moisture. These tests typically involve exposing the luggage to water jets and measuring how much water penetrates. A research report by the International Journal of Industrial Research illustrated that materials like polyester and nylon offer varied degrees of water resistance. This testing ensures that travel essentials remain dry in adverse weather conditions.

Zipper Performance Tests: Zipper performance tests assess the reliability and durability of zippers under multiple uses. These tests evaluate how easily zippers open and close, as well as their resistance to breakage. According to testing conducted by The Good Housekeeping Institute, zippers should be robust enough to endure frequent use without jamming or splitting.

Wheel Mobility Tests: Wheel mobility tests evaluate how smoothly luggage can roll in various conditions. This includes testing wheel resilience on different surfaces and maneuverability during turns. Research by the Travel Goods Association indicates that luggage with four wheels generally offers better mobility than two-wheel counterparts. This test ensures ease of transportation.

Safety Features Evaluation: Safety features evaluation checks elements designed to protect user belongings, like anti-theft locks. Testing for these features involves simulating theft attempts to evaluate effectiveness. A 2021 study by the Security Research Group noted that well-designed safety features can significantly reduce the risk of theft during travel.

Size and Capacity Measurements: Size and capacity measurements determine the dimensions and volume of luggage. These metrics are critical for compatibility with airline regulations. Measurements are often checked against industry standards provided by organizations like the International Air Transport Association (IATA). Accurate measurements ensure users select suitable luggage for air travel.

Material Quality Analysis: Material quality analysis examines the fibers and materials used in luggage construction. This includes testing for strength, flexibility, and resistance to environmental factors. Research by the Journal of Materials Engineering identifies that high-quality materials enhance durability and performance in luggage products. This analysis informs manufacturers about material choices that affect overall product quality.

Why Is Warranty and Customer Support Critical When Choosing Luggage?

When choosing luggage, warranty and customer support are critical factors. A good warranty ensures protection against defects and damage, while robust customer support provides assistance when issues arise.

According to the Consumer Product Safety Commission, a warranty is a manufacturer’s promise that a product will meet certain performance standards. Reliable customer support helps consumers resolve problems efficiently.

The reasons warranty and customer support are vital include protection from manufacturing defects and providing reassurance. A strong warranty indicates the manufacturer’s confidence in the product’s quality. Good customer support reassures buyers that help is available for any concerns.

A warranty can cover manufacturing flaws, such as stitching failures or wheel malfunctions. Customer support is important for troubleshooting issues, answering questions, and facilitating repairs or replacements. Both elements enhance the overall customer experience.

For instance, a common luggage issue is a broken zipper. If a product has a warranty, the manufacturer may repair or replace it without additional costs. Customer support can guide the owner through the return process, ensuring transparency and convenience.

Choosing luggage with a solid warranty and accessible customer support helps consumers avoid potential frustrations and ensures they receive assistance when needed.
